Get in Touch** The Audi repair market accessible to Cottage Grove residents is characterized by high quality and moderate competition, concentrated in nearby Eugene. Cottage Grove itself lacks specialized Audi providers, forcing owners to rely on general mechanics for basic services or travel to Eugene for expert care. The Eugene market is robust, featuring a clear hierarchy: a top-tier independent specialist (Cascade German Auto), the factory-backed dealership (Lithia Audi), and a renowned performance tuner (Symmetry Tuning). This provides Audi owners with excellent, complementary options depending on their needs—from warranty work and complex diagnostics to performance enhancements. Pricing in this market is premium, reflecting the specialized knowledge, proprietary tools, and high-quality parts required for Audi vehicles. Independent specialists typically offer rates 20-30% lower than the dealership, making them a popular choice for out-of-warranty vehicles. Overall, while Cottage Grove residents must travel a short distance, they have access to a competitively priced and technically excellent Audi service ecosystem.

Given Cottage Grove's wet climate and proximity to forest roads, we frequently address Quattro all-wheel-drive system maintenance, electrical issues from moisture, and suspension wear from rough or gravel roads. Regular checks on seals, sensors, and undercarriage components are especially important here to prevent costly repairs.
Look for a shop with certified Audi or European-specialist technicians, such as those with ASE certification. In Cottage Grove and the surrounding South Lane County area, seek out shops with strong local reputations, verified customer reviews, and direct experience with modern Audi diagnostics and complex systems.
While dealer labor rates are typically higher, using a trusted local independent specialist in Cottage Grove can offer significant savings on labor and sometimes parts, without a long drive. The key is comparing the shop's expertise and warranty on repairs against the dealer's convenience and OEM parts guarantee.
Seek immediate local service for critical warnings like oil pressure, coolant temperature, or serious brake system alerts, as driving to Eugene could cause severe damage. For less urgent lights, a Cottage Grove shop with proper Audi diagnostic scanners can often read codes and advise you safely, saving an unnecessary trip.
Frequent short trips around town, combined with damp conditions and seasonal temperature shifts, can lead to battery strain, interior mold/mildew, and increased brake corrosion. We recommend more frequent battery checks, cabin air filter changes, and brake inspections than the standard manual intervals suggest.
